North Carolina General Statutes § 58-58-5 Industrial life insurance defined

Industrial life insurance is hereby declared to be that form of life insurance under which the premiums are payable monthly or oftener, provided the face amount of insurance stated in the policy does not exceed one thousand dollars ($1,000) and the words "Industrial Policy" are printed upon the policy as a part of the descriptive matter. (1945, c. 379; 1947, c. 721.)
